Key knowledge of mathematics in the first half of grade three:
Chapter 21 Quadratic Radicals
Emphasis: Concepts, properties and operations related to quadratic roots.
Difficulty: the denominator of the operation of quadratic square root is physical and chemical, and the size is relatively large.
Error-prone point: the operation of quadratic root, symbol
Chapter 22 One-variable quadratic equation
Emphasis: Definition, solution, Vieta's theorem and application of quadratic equation in one variable.
Difficulties: solution (matching method) and its application, Vieta theorem.
Error-prone point: the solution of quadratic equation in one variable
Chapter 23 Rotation
Emphasis: central symmetry (definition, properties, drawing and application)
Difficulty: application of rotation (typical topic)
Error-prone point: the difference between central symmetry and central symmetry graphics
Chapter 24 Circle
Emphasis: vertical diameter theorem, position relationship with circle, sector area, arc length formula, tangent length theorem.
Difficulty: circular power theorem
Error-prone point: the side development diagram of the cone
The compulsory test in the senior high school entrance examination: the proof of the tangent of the circle
Chapter 25 Preliminary Probability
Key points: solutions of events and probabilities (list method and tree diagram)
Difficulty: the solution of probability when an experiment involves multiple factors.
Error-prone points: repetition and omission
